EA FC 26 released its November Feedback Update on November 26th. This update brought no substantial changes, mainly serving as a review of their update plans and arrangements for upcoming updates.

Players were undoubtedly disappointed with this update, as it was filled with empty promises rather than detailed solutions, specifics, or timely actions.

EA FC 26 November Feedback Update Disappoints Players | No Real Fixes, AI Defense Issues & December Nerfs Expected

November Feedback Update Content

The developers believe that the shooting and goalkeeping are still severely unbalanced, and therefore goalkeeper movement will be nerfed in the December update.

Regarding the defensive AI, the developers stated that the adjustments were made due to previous enhancements to jockeying, and that any future changes would be announced in advance, but no new measures were announced.

Additionally, the developers acknowledged that the computer-controlled AI in Squad Battles mode was too powerful. Their initial intention was to make defensive phases more interesting and reduce frustration when off the ball, but the changes have actually worsened the game environment. The developers stated that they won't be able to resolve this issue until early 2026.

Player Feedback For Updates

Many players believe that FC 26 updates until now not only failed to solve the problems but actually made the game worse.

Manual Defense

Even players with excellent manual defense skills, able to use manual tackles and interceptions to stop attacks, cannot secure possession.

This is because after a defensive player completes a defensive action, there is a brief period of recovery time, during which the attacking team can immediately regain possession and launch an attack.

Slow Player Reactions

Players on the field respond to control commands with a delay, and many players have reported latency exceeding 60ms, making gameplay very clunky.

Speed Attribute Anomaly

The current pace stat behaves abnormally. Claudia Pina (86 OVR) only has a pace of 79, yet she can outpace players faster than her in matches. This speed anomaly isn't limited to Pina; Virgil van Dijk also exhibits this issue. The pace stat has been problematic for some time, but the developers haven't fixed it.

Updates Changed The Game Environment

At launch, FIFA 26 offered a rich variety of tactics and formations. However, after the update v1.1.0, 4-5-1 formation became the only dominant meta formation. This formation packs a large number of players into the midfield, forming a dense, wall-like defense.

Furthermore, due to the overly powerful defensive AI, players now tend to avoid manually controlling defensive players. Instead, they hold down the R1 button to call for teammates to provide support, letting the AI handle the defense automatically, while manually controlling forwards to track back and harass. This defensive approach requires no skill but is highly effective, resulting in almost every player becoming a defensive expert.

Corresponding to this passive defense, players' offensive methods have also become limited. Currently, players primarily rely on high-speed wing breakthroughs followed by cutback passes or finesse shots from the edge of the penalty area. Beyond these attacking methods, other offensive and defensive maneuvers are largely ineffective.

This environment frustrates players who value manual control and diverse attacking styles. Because each match's lineup and flow are similar, they find the game less engaging.

FC 26 Current Status

The first 3-4 weeks after release were the best time of EA FC 26, and even for FIFA series in recent years. It was highly responsive, with timely feedback. Manual defense and interceptions were effectively rewarded, and successful tackles kept the ball firmly in place.

Furthermore, the lack of a unified meta allowed for various formations and tactics to be effective, making the game exciting and resulting in high player retention and online player numbers.

However, the developers didn't give players enough time to adapt to the initial excellent controls. Instead, they prematurely heeded complaints from players who weren't skilled at manual defense, mistakenly buffing the AI defending. The developers should prioritize fixing defensive issues with kickoffs and corners, incorrect pass selection (especially leading to offsides), and the unbearable input delay on consoles.

The October and November updates regressed the game to the AI-dependent, passively defensive, and frustrating state of its predecessors, FUT 24 and FC 25, erasing all the strengths of its initial release.

The current disappointing gameplay will only lead to player churn. Even with abundant in-game events like Thunderstruck sales and tournaments, the poor core gameplay renders everything meaningless.

November Feedback Update reviewed the main content of official patches since the game's release, and the developers acknowledged that the patches introduced many problems. It's currently unknown whether the official December patch will fix these issues. However, the simplest and most direct way to make the game fun again is to roll back the game version, building the December update on top of the initial release version and only fixing genuine bugs like kickoffs and corner kicks, rather than changing the core gameplay.
